如何备考PostgreSQL中级认证

以下是一些备考 PostgreSQL 中级认证方法:

一、知识储备阶段

1、深入学习官方文档

PostgreSQL 官方文档是最权威的学习资源。仔细研读关于数据库架构、SQL 语法、数据类型、函数和操作符等基础部分。例如,了解 PostgreSQL 支持的丰富数据类型,如数组类型(int [])、JSON 数据类型等,以及如何在实际应用中使用它们。

对于高级特性,如存储过程和函数的编写,要掌握其语法和应用场景。比如,学习如何使用 postgreSQL自定义函数来实现复杂的业务逻辑。

2、阅读专业书籍

选择一些经典的 PostgreSQL 书籍,如《PostgreSQL 实战》等。这些书籍会系统地介绍数据库的原理、操作和优化技巧。通过阅读书籍,可以加深对数据库概念的理解,如事务隔离级别。书中会详细解释不同隔离级别(如读未提交、读已提交、可重复读和串行化)的特点和适用场景,帮助你在考试和实际工作中正确应用。

3、学习数据库设计理论

理解如何设计合理的数据库结构,避免数据冗余和更新异常。例如,在设计一个电商系统的数据库时,要知道如何将用户信息、商品信息、订单信息等合理地划分到不同的表中,以满足第三范式的要求。

二、实践操作阶段

1、搭建实验环境

在本地搭建 PostgreSQL 数据库环境。可以通过安装包在本地计算机上安装 PostgreSQL,然后进行配置。

利用这个环境进行大量的实践操作,包括创建数据库、表、索引,插入、更新和删除数据等基本操作。尝试创建不同类型的索引,如 B - 树索引、哈希索引等,观察它们在不同查询场景下的性能差异。

2、进行实际项目案例练习

从网上寻找开源的数据库项目案例,或者自己模拟一些业务场景进行数据库设计和实现。例如,设计一个简单的员工管理系统数据库,包括员工基本信息表、部门表、工资表等,并且实现员工信息查询、部门绩效统计等功能。

参与开源项目的贡献,在真实的开发环境中理解数据库的应用。比如,可以参与一些基于 PostgreSQL 的小型 Web 应用项目,帮助优化数据库查询性能或者改进数据库架构。

三、模拟考试与巩固阶段

1、寻找官方或权威模拟试题

如果你是零基础或初学者可以到重庆思庄认证学习中心的数据库研究院获取模拟试题,这些试题通常最接近真实考试的题型和难度。按照考试规定的时间和要求进行模拟考试,了解自己的知识薄弱点。

分析模拟考试的结果,针对错误的题目,重新复习相关知识点。例如,如果在事务管理部分的题目出错较多,就需要再次深入学习事务的特性和相关的控制语句。

2、参加培训课程和学习社区

报名参加重庆思庄认证学习中心的 PostgreSQL 中级认证培训课程,培训讲师可以提供系统的学习指导和解题技巧。加入学习社区(如 CSDN 的 PostgreSQL 板块、重庆思庄PostgreSQL学习论坛等)中与其他学习者交流经验,分享学习心得和解决问题的方法。

学习社区中的案例分享和问题解答能够拓宽你的视野,让你了解到在实际应用中可能遇到的各种情况。例如,通过社区了解到如何在高并发环境下优化 PostgreSQL 数据库的性能,这对于备考和实际工作都非常有帮助。

相关推荐
Franciz小测测14 分钟前
Python APScheduler 定时任务 独立调度系统设计与实现
java·数据库·sql
不穿格子的程序员15 分钟前
MySQL篇6——MySQL深度揭秘:主从复制原理、流程与同步方式详解
数据库·mysql·主从复制
蠢货爱好者17 分钟前
MySQL小练习
数据库·mysql
头发那是一根不剩了27 分钟前
MySQL 启动、连接问题汇总
数据库·mysql·adb
雪域迷影2 小时前
完整的后端课程 | NodeJS、ExpressJS、JWT、Prisma、PostgreSQL
数据库·postgresql·node.js·express·prisma
一颗宁檬不酸9 小时前
文件管理知识点
数据库
10 小时前
达梦数据库-事务
数据库·达梦数据库·dm
网硕互联的小客服10 小时前
MYSQL数据库和MSSQL数据库有什么区别?分别适用于什么脚本程序?
数据库·mysql·sqlserver
weixin_4624462311 小时前
【原创实践】python 获取节假日列表 并保存为excel
数据库·python·excel
RPA 机器人就找八爪鱼11 小时前
RPA 赋能银行数字化转型:四大核心应用场景深度解析
数据库·人工智能·rpa